Olivia O, The Musical will present a Concert Reading at the Theatre on the Verge Festival of New Musicals on Saturday March 23, 2024!
The performance will begin at 6:30 pm at the beautiful Abington Art Center in Jenkintown, PA.
With a Book and Lyrics by Diane Currie Sam and Jessica Carmona, Original Music Composed and arranged by Gil Yaron, Musical Direction by Guilherme Andreas. The musical tells the story of 14 year old Olivia, a migrant child from Guatemala who gets separated from her mother at the US-Mexican Border and tries to reunite with her family in El Paso, Texas.
Her aunt, Isabel works with her community of activists and friends to find her niece. As they navigate the complicated and messy web of the US Immigration system, they learn the power and strength that they have when they come together with love, determination and faith for a common goal. They learn that no one can stop them when they have love and community on their side.
The cast is made up of primarily Latine Actors and Singers, and Directed by Latina Director Jennica Carmona.
